Cardi B Hits the Streets to Promote “Am I The Drama?”

Cardi B brought a playful nod to hip-hop’s Golden Era by personally selling copies of her upcoming album, “Am I The Drama?” on the streets of Manhattan. A clip shared on her Instagram shows her engaging fans directly, displaying different editions of the album while wearing a Rastacap, waving incense, and playing Bob Marley in the background.

“My label said I gotta get out in these streets and sell this album,” Cardi captioned the post. The comedic moment drew reactions from celebrities and fans alike. Ebro joked about her selling essential oils alongside the albums. Tyla responded with laughing emojis, and Kehlani complimented Cardi on wearing her hoodie. Producer Jay Versace poked fun at the black SUV in the background.

The clip’s humor resonated with New York City residents, especially the exaggerated album prices, highlighting Cardi’s playful approach. While the album is not actually $50, the joke showcased her willingness to engage fans and her connection to her roots.

Cardi B confirmed she will prepare for a tour following the album’s release. Rumors about pregnancy have circulated recently, but the Bronx rapper has yet to embark on a full-length arena tour. Her 2019 tour consisted mainly of festival dates, and nearly seven years after her debut album, fans are eager to see if she can create another major event around her new release.

“Am I The Drama?” reflects Cardi B’s personality, blending humor, showmanship, and a strong connection to her fans, while setting the stage for her next chapter in hip-hop and live performances.
